電子ブロック工房:
Deprecated: Function strftime() is deprecated in /home/u109394186/domains/rad51.net/public_html/jeans/jeans/libs/blog.php on line 333
2026年 06月の記事

PC上でMachiKaniaプログラミング [MachiKania]

2026年6月19日

MachiKania type P/PU では従来より、pc-connect 機能により、PC と MachiKania を USB ケーブルで繋ぎ、PC 上のファイルを MachiKania に転送して実行する方法を提供してきました。 Ver 1.7.0 以降では、それに加えて、PC 上のターミナルソフトで MachiKania 上の BASIC プログラムを編集・実行することができるようになりました。

20260615-PC-MachiKania.jpg

設定方法の詳細は、MachiKania type PUの公式ページでの説明を参照してください。ここでは、このページで提供する zip アーカイブを用いた、簡便な方法について説明します。

MachiKania type P/PU ver 1.7.0を公開 [MachiKania]

2026年6月19日

MachiKania type P/PU ver 1.7.0 を公開しました。

https://github.com/machikania/phyllosoma/releases/tag/Ver1.7.0

今回の更新の目玉は、以下の通りです。
Waveshare RP2350-Touch-LCD-2 (Wiki) に対応
・CST816D, TBUTTON, QMI8658 の3つのクラスを追加
・USBキーボードドライバにPCのターミナルソフトから直接文字コードで入力する機能を追加
・MachiKania USB ゲームパッドに対応
・文字列演算子(=, !=, <, <=, >, >=, AND, OR)を追加
・IF などで文字列を条件式に取ることができるようにした
・年齢制限のあるアプリケーションの開発に対応

20260601-RP2350-LCD-2.png

GitHub リリースページはこちら
Type P 公式ホームページはこちら
Type PU 公式ホームページはこちら